U.S. Behavioral Health Market Size Expected to Reach USD 159.35 Bn by 2035
The U.S. behavioral health market is valued at $101.84 billion in 2026 and is expected to grow to $159.35 billion by 2035 at a 5.1% CAGR. The market is driven by rising prevalence of mental health disorders affecting 50 million Americans, with outpatient counseling dominating at 41.5% market share and depression/anxiety disorders accounting for 38% of cases. Key growth areas include home-based treatment services and substance abuse disorder treatment.

UHS Bets On Online Therapy Boom With Talkspace Takeover
Universal Health Services announced a definitive agreement to acquire Talkspace for $5.25 per share, valuing the deal at approximately $835 million. The acquisition aims to strengthen UHS's outpatient strategy and expand access to virtual behavioral healthcare through Talkspace's platform of 6,000 licensed professionals. Talkspace generated $229 million in revenue in 2025 from over 1.6 million therapy and psychiatry sessions.

Company Profile
Universal Health Services, Inc., through its subsidiaries, owns and operates acute care hospitals, and outpatient and behavioral health care facilities in the United States. It operates through Acute Care Hospital Services and Behavioral Health Care Services segments. The company's hospitals offer general and specialty surgery, internal medicine, obstetrics, emergency room care, radiology, oncology, diagnostic and coronary care, pediatric, pharmacy, and/or behavioral health services. It also provides commercial health insurance services; capital resources; and various management services, including central purchasing, information services, finance and control systems, facilities planning, physician recruitment, administrative personnel management, marketing, and public relations services. Universal Health Services, Inc. was founded in 1978 and is headquartered in King of Prussia, Pennsylvania.
